Output 31f5ab41cb762cbe856eaec185eb64d272629c03777a7a793e4eb1515647f0c5:21

value
9398382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21dac10a2044bda746cf71afaa8bb4097954c8bf OP_EQUAL
address
34n2HAyRPik1bNumxux3VLe7goVu2uQXg6
transaction
31f5ab41cb762cbe856eaec185eb64d272629c03777a7a793e4eb1515647f0c5
spent
true